Output 75cb4e1eef93495e2a4e2e125fce1986fc865762a8e92aa17e5dce2802f4634e:1

value
19765000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2dcebae6a2be55803002b6dc4c7416cbeb6cfa3a OP_EQUAL
address
35sDz2vgbke5TRm45z3xczw7U4GG7mPMeN
transaction
75cb4e1eef93495e2a4e2e125fce1986fc865762a8e92aa17e5dce2802f4634e
confirmations
418566
spent
true